Rule 7062. Stay of Proceedings to Enforce a Judgment
Rule 62 F.R.Civ.P. applies in adversary proceedings. An order granting relief from an automatic stay provided by §362, §922, §1201, or §1301 of the Code, an order authorizing or prohibiting the use of cash collateral or the use, sale or lease of property of the estate under §363, an order authorizing the trustee to obtain credit pursuant to §364, and an order authorizing the assumption or assignment of an executory contract or unexpired lease pursuant to §365 shall be additional exceptions to Rule 62(a).
(As amended Apr. 30, 1991, eff. Aug. 1, 1991.)
Notes of Advisory Committee on RulesThe additional exceptions set forth in this rule make applicable to those matters the consequences contained in Rule 62(c) and (d) with respect to orders in actions for injunctions.
Notes of Advisory Committee on Rules—1991 AmendmentThis rule is amended to include as additional exceptions to Rule 62(a) an order granting relief from the automatic stay of actions against codebtors provided by §1201 of the Code, the sale or lease of property of the estate under §363, and the assumption or assignment of an executory contract under §365.
